Environmental Impact Study of the Northern Section of the Upper Mississippi River. Pool 5.

Abstract

The overall objectives of this report are to assess, both negative and positive, impacts of Corps of Engineers' activities on Pool 5 (Minnesota City, Minnesota) of the Upper Mississippi River. An analysis of natural and socioeconomic systems is included. The natural systems include terrestrial and aquatic plant and animal life, geology and water quality. Socioeconomic systems include industrial and recreational activities, including cultural considerations, such as historic sites. (Author)
